Labor Day weekend diving

Did some diving Sun and Mon. Sunday out of Clearwater (weatherman got it wrong, so bumpy a bit) Monday out of St Pete on a new ride for me for the first time. My good friend Cpt Ty set it up and was on the boat and off we went. Calm on Monday.
Neither day was particularly fishy. Viz was 20-30 each day in 80-100. Temp 87.

Quote:
Originally Posted by Spear One View Post
Loved your "out of the box" thinking by stringing the Gag (vs. yanking on the shaft and risking a pull out) in order to get a secure enough grip to wiggle the fish out of that narrow crack.
I watched that with interest as well. I have had grouper that were badly stuck in a hole and still alive, rather than trying to fight them and pull them out, I have used a knife (by touch and without seeing) to brain them first while still way back in the hole.
